What are the closest trade schools offering hands-on programs for residents of Dumont, Iowa?

The most accessible options for Dumont residents include Hawkeye Community College in Waterloo (about 45 minutes away), North Iowa Area Community College (NIACC) in Mason City (roughly an hour's drive), and Iowa Central Community College's Triton Trade School in Fort Dodge (approximately 1.5 hours away). These schools offer in-person and sometimes hybrid programs in trades like welding, automotive technology, and HVAC.

Are there any short-term certification programs available near Dumont for someone looking to quickly enter the trades?

Yes, several nearby community colleges offer short-term certificates. For example, Hawkeye Community College offers accelerated certificates in Welding (often completed in one semester) and HVAC-R essentials. Iowa Central's Triton Trade School also provides focused, short-duration programs in areas like Plumbing Basics and Automotive Repair that can be completed in under a year, allowing for quicker entry into the workforce.

What financial aid or scholarship opportunities are specifically available for Dumont students attending trade schools in Iowa?

Dumont students can apply for Iowa's Last-Dollar Scholarship, which covers tuition gaps for high-demand programs like welding, HVAC, and electrical technology at eligible colleges like NIACC and Hawkeye. Additionally, many local foundations, such as the Butler County Community Foundation and agricultural co-ops, offer scholarships for trade students pursuing careers in fields vital to the region's economy.
